Figure 6
Colocalization of T2R138 and chromogranin A in the mouse small intestine.

Tissue sections from mouse proximal intestine were embedded in paraffin and analyzed for expression of the T2R138 taste receptor protein (green) and chromogranin A protein (red) by immunofluorescence (scale bars: 10 μm). T2R138 colocalized with chromogranin A as shown in the merged image (yellow), and the two proteins localized at the apical membrane (triangle) in a small fraction of total cells.
